5800编程里面dimz是什么意思

fiy 其他 32

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在编程中,"dimz"通常是一个变量或数组的声明和定义语句中使用的关键字。它的作用是指定变量或数组在声明时的维度或大小。

    在一些编程语言中,如BASIC和VB.NET,"dimz"用于声明一个具有固定大小的数组。例如:

    dimz myArray(10) '声明一个长度为11的数组

    在上述代码中,"myArray"是一个长度为11的数组,可以存储11个元素。

    而在其他编程语言中,如MATLAB,"dimz"用于声明一个多维数组的大小。例如:

    dimz myMatrix[3, 4] '声明一个3行4列的矩阵

    在上述代码中,"myMatrix"是一个3行4列的矩阵,可以存储12个元素。

    总之,"dimz"是一个在编程中用于声明和定义变量或数组大小的关键字。具体使用方式和含义可能会因编程语言而异,需要根据具体的编程语言文档或语法规范进行参考和理解。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在5800编程中,"dimz"是一个特定的关键字,表示声明一个数组或矩阵,并指定其维度。这个关键字用于定义一个具有固定大小的数组,可以在程序中存储和处理多个数据项。

    下面是关于"dimz"的一些重要信息:

    1. 数组声明:使用"dimz"关键字可以声明一个数组,指定其维度。例如,"dimz arr[10]"表示声明一个包含10个元素的数组。这意味着arr[0]到arr[9]共有10个位置可以存储数据。

    2. 多维数组:使用"dimz"关键字还可以声明多维数组。例如,"dimz matrix[3][3]"表示声明一个3×3的矩阵。这意味着matrix[0][0]到matrix[2][2]共有9个位置可以存储数据。

    3. 数组初始化:在使用"dimz"声明数组时,可以选择性地为数组元素指定初始值。例如,"dimz arr[5] = {1, 2, 3, 4, 5}"表示声明一个包含5个元素的数组,并将其初始化为1、2、3、4和5。

    4. 数组访问:使用数组名和索引值可以访问数组中的特定元素。例如,"arr[2]"表示访问arr数组中的第3个元素。

    5. 数组长度:可以使用"dimz"声明的数组具有固定的长度,无法在程序运行过程中改变。这意味着一旦数组被声明,其大小就不能再修改。

    总结起来,"dimz"是一个用于声明数组或矩阵并指定其维度的关键字。它在5800编程中用于创建具有固定大小的数组,可以存储和处理多个数据项。通过使用"dimz",我们可以方便地创建和操作数组,提高程序的灵活性和效率。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在5800编程中,dimz是用于声明一个动态数组的关键字。dimz是由dim和z两个单词组成的,dim是dimension(维度)的缩写,z表示零,因此dimz可以理解为声明一个零维数组。

    动态数组是在程序运行时动态分配内存空间的数组,可以根据需要动态地改变数组的大小。与之相对的是静态数组,静态数组在编译时就需要确定数组的大小,不能动态改变。

    使用dimz关键字声明动态数组,可以在程序运行时根据需要动态分配内存空间。具体的操作流程如下:

    1. 在程序中使用dimz关键字声明一个动态数组。语法格式为:dimz 数组名[数组长度]。

    2. 在程序运行时,根据需要为动态数组分配内存空间。可以使用函数如malloc()或new来分配内存。

    3. 使用动态数组。可以通过下标来访问和修改数组元素的值。注意,动态数组的下标从0开始。

    4. 在不需要使用动态数组时,应该手动释放内存空间,以避免内存泄漏。可以使用函数如free()或delete来释放内存。

    需要注意的是,使用动态数组需要谨慎,因为动态分配的内存空间需要手动释放,否则会造成内存泄漏。在使用动态数组时,需要确保正确分配和释放内存,以避免程序出现错误或内存溢出的问题。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部